With a stay at Hotel Ocean, you'll be centrally located in Naha, steps from Kokusai-dori Shopping Street and 10 minutes by foot from DFS Galleria Okinawa. This family-friendly hotel is 9 mi (14.5 km) from American Village and 5.7 mi (9.2 km) from Senaga Island. Take advantage of recreation opportunities such as an outdoor pool, or other amenities including complimentary wireless internet access and an arcade/game room. Additional amenities at this hotel include tour/ticket assistance, a banquet hall, and a vending machine. Enjoy a meal at Sky Lounge or snacks in the hotel's coffee shop/cafe. Wrap up your day with a drink at the bar/lounge. Buffet breakfasts are available daily from 6:30 AM to 10:00 AM for a fee. Featured amenities include a 24-hour front desk, multilingual staff, and luggage storage. Planning an event in Naha? This hotel has 538 square feet (50 square meters) of space consisting of conference space and meeting rooms. Self parking (subject to charges) is available onsite. Stay in one of 93 guestrooms featuring flat-screen televisions. Complimentary wireless internet access keeps you connected, and satellite programming is available for your entertainment. Bathrooms have complimentary toiletries and bidets.

LLinyinaiFacilities: Hyatt's facilities are unbeatable, and the size is quite large for Japan. The breakfast selection was a bit limited and didn't change much over three days, but the food itself was delicious. The swimming pool is small, but better than nothing. The hot water temperature wasn't very stable at night, fluctuating quite a bit. And for some reason, the toilet lid kept falling down and hitting me. Other than that, everything else was fine. Service: Couldn't be better. Every time we arrived by taxi, the trunk was opened before we even got out, and they'd even help us check if we'd left anything in the seat 😂. All the staff spoke excellent English. Location: It's about 1600 JPY by taxi to the airport and around 5000 JPY to American Village. Kokusai Dori is a one-minute walk away, and there's a convenience store about 200 meters from the entrance. The pottery street across the road is fun to browse and shop. However, it's quite a distance from the port, the bus terminal, and Naminoue Shrine. I'd recommend staying closer to the bus terminal area. Kokusai Dori is a bit of a tourist trap for food, and there's not much else to see or do there.

VvvvankoSticking to my principle of 'new over old,' I ultimately chose this hotel in the city center. 'The Nest,' newly opened in 2025, cost only 1700+ for 3 nights during the off-peak season – incredible value for money! 📍 **Location** It's about an 18-minute walk to Kokusai Dori, and roughly a 5-minute walk to Asahibashi monorail station. Naha Bus Terminal is about a 10-minute walk away. The transportation is very convenient, which is a huge plus for us since we couldn't drive. 🛌 **Room Amenities** We booked a triple room. One of the beds was a sofa bed, allowing two adults and one child to sleep undisturbed. The bathroom had a three-way separation design with a shower area – it was my first time staying in a Japanese hotel without a bathtub! 😂 The room's downsides were, firstly, no wardrobe, just a hanging rack, and secondly, only a small coffee table, so storage space was very limited. 🏊 **Hotel Facilities** There's an open-air swimming pool on the hotel's top floor, with drinks offered at specific times. It was too cold for us to try it out, but it seems many people choose this hotel specifically for the pool. 🧩 **Nearby Facilities** There are three convenience stores nearby – Lawson and 7-Eleven – making it very convenient to stock up on snacks. The famous Jack's Steak House is also in the vicinity. 📝 **Other Notes** When checking in, they provided amenities for children (toothbrush, toothpaste, and a scrubbing sponge 🧽). We stayed for three nights in total, and housekeeping services were not provided for those three nights. Every day before heading out, we'd leave our trash and used towels outside our door for collection. When we returned, fresh towels and water would be waiting for us at the door.
